Job Description

As an HR Operations, Compensation & Benefits Specialist, you will play a crucial role in managing and executing HR operations related to compensation and benefits. Your expertise will ensure that the company’s compensation structure is competitive, compliant, and tailored to meet organizational goals while attracting and retaining top talent. You'll be responsible for the administrative aspects of HR operations, ensuring that benefits are well-communicated, and employees are satisfied with their compensation packages. This role involves working with a diverse team and requires excellent analytical skills to evaluate and optimize compensation systems. Your contributions will directly impact employee satisfaction and organizational performance, necessitating a balance of strategic thinking and attention to detail.


Responsibilities

  • Develop and manage compensation strategies aligning with organizational objectives and market demands.
  • Oversee the administration of employee benefits programs including health insurance and retirement plans.
  • Conduct regular salary benchmarking and market analysis to ensure competitive pay practices.
  • Collaborate with HR teams to ensure smooth execution of compensation and benefits processes.
  • Prepare reports and provide insights on compensation metrics to support decision-making.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ant labor laws and regulations impacting compensation and benefits.
  • Engage with third-party service providers to negotiate and manage benefits programs and perks.
  • Educate employees about benefits programs and address any inquiries or issues they may have.
  • Support the development of fiscal plans and budgets related to employee compensation and benefits.
  • Conduct audits to ensure data accuracy and integrity in compensation databases and systems.
  • Implement new compensation initiatives and promote best HR practices across the organization.
  • Monitor trends in compensation and benefits to recommend strategic adjustments as necessary.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field required.
  • Minimum of three years of experience in HR operations or compensation and benefits roles.
  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to manage and interpret data effectively.
  • Excellent communication skills for interacting with employees and external partners.
  • In-depth knowledge of labor law and compensation regulations in relevant jurisdictions.
  • Proficiency in HRIS and MS Office Suite, particularly Excel for data analysis.
  • Experience with salary surveys and various compensation tools and methodologies.
